Output e150852f6071e3405a1486a9f18325d55deffc77f155fa1e8c32053645d8dd9e:0

value
267000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e7d2e6f3622de6f5828f61ea82b7aa3ed4bd843 OP_EQUAL
address
35vpy867eqQCnjTzpaVaZvAaxpGiK1a42i
transaction
e150852f6071e3405a1486a9f18325d55deffc77f155fa1e8c32053645d8dd9e
spent
true